The Warning Signs of Gutter Overflow Water Removal You Can’t Afford to Ignore

Identifying the signs of gutter overflow water removal early on can make all the difference in reducing damage and preventing further issues. Our team has seen firsthand the devastating consequences of neglected water damage, and we’re here to guide you through the process of prevention and restoration.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ant Smells are often the first s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can show the presence of mold, bacteria, or other contaminants that can pose serious health risks. Our team will work with you to identify and address the source of the issue.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Visible Signs of water damage can be subtle, but they shouldn’t be ignored. Water stains on walls or ceilings can show a more extensive problem, one that needs prompt attention to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Warped Wood

Structural Damage can be hidden beneath the surface. Peeling paint or warped wood can show that water has seeped into the underlying structures of your home, compromising its integrity.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Strange Noises or water leaks can be a sign that the issue is more extensive than you initially thought.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address the problem head-on with our expert guidance.

Excessive Moisture or Humidity

Rising Humidity can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and other issues. Our team will work with you to identify and address the root cause of excessive moisture, ensuring your home remains safe and healthy.

Discoloration or Warping of Flooring

Subtle Signs of water damage can be subtle, but they shouldn’t be ignored. Discoloration or warping of flooring can show that water has seeped into the underlying structures of your home, compromising its integrity.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, isolated area of water damage Yes No DIY is often enough for small, contained areas of water damage.
Widespread water damage affecting multiple rooms No Yes For extensive water damage, it’s best to call a professional to ensure safe and efficient drying and restoration.
Presence of mold or bacterial growth No Yes Mold and bacteria can pose serious health risks, and only a professional can safely and effectively address these issues.
Water damage affecting structural elements (e.g., walls, floors) No Yes Structural damage needs specialized expertise and equipment to prevent further compromise of the building’s integrity.
Highly contaminated water sources (e.g., sewer backup) No Yes Highly contaminated water poses serious health risks and need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ely.
Insurance claim or dispute No Yes Our team has extensive experience working with insurance companies and can guide you through the claims process and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ost in Millen, GA

The cost of gutter overflow water removal in Millen, GA can vary a lot depending on the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. Our team will work with you to provide a customized estimate for your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Extent of damage, location of affected area, and local conditions
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, complexity of extraction, and equipment required
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ment required, and duration of drying process
Inspection and Cleaning $200 – $1,000 Extent of damage, type of materials affected, and complexity of cleaning
Final Inspection and Certification $100 – $500 Scope of work completed, final assessment of damage, and certification requirements

The prices listed above are estimates and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will work with you to provide a customized estimate for your gutter overflow water removal needs.
